扩大
缩小
  
摘要: 开发环境以及IDE准备相关: 1、JAVA环境搭建 2、初次使用IntelliJ IDEA 3、IntelliJ IDEA界面设置 4、IntelliJ IDEA快捷键介绍 SprintBoot系列: 第一章:第一个Springboot应用 第二章:lombok介绍及简单使用 第三章:springb 阅读全文
posted @ 2019-01-17 11:23 风筝遇上风 阅读(493) 评论(0) 推荐(0) 编辑
摘要: 参考资料: .Net Core官网 https://www.microsoft.com/net/core 官方文档: https://docs.asp.net 博客园中文文档: http://www.cnblogs.com/dotNETCoreSG/p/aspnetcore-index.html 授 阅读全文
posted @ 2016-10-19 10:14 风筝遇上风 阅读(439) 评论(0) 推荐(1) 编辑
摘要: 一、Sql语句的性能优化 二、Quartz.NET的介绍 三、Log4.Net的介绍 四、Topshelf的介绍 五、Git的使用 六、IEnumerable接口迭代原理 七、Lambada表达式的演变历程 附注:以上系列文章博主都会围绕【是什么】、【官方文档、资料】、【怎么用】、【具体解析】这四大 阅读全文
posted @ 2016-03-15 16:18 风筝遇上风 阅读(218) 评论(0) 推荐(0) 编辑
摘要: Object学习目录: 1.OC概述 2.OC第一个应用程序 3.OC之类和对象(属性、方法,点语法) 4.OC之类的扩充(self,super关键字、继承、构造函数等) 5.OC之分类Category,协议Protocol,Copy,代码块block 6.OC之内存管理 7.OC之KVC、KVO 阅读全文
posted @ 2015-10-30 17:17 风筝遇上风 阅读(220) 评论(0) 推荐(0) 编辑
摘要: 数据库的优化方案核心本质有三种:减少数据量、用空间换性能、选择合适的存储系统,这也对应了开篇讲解的慢的三个原因:数据总量、高负载、查找的时间复杂度。 一、减少数据量 数据序列化存储、数据归档、中间表生成、分库分表。 二、用空间换性能 该类型的两个方案都是用来应对高负载的场景,方案有以下两种:分布式缓 阅读全文
posted @ 2024-04-26 14:09 风筝遇上风 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 一、数据库性能瓶颈-IO瓶颈 第一种:磁盘读IO瓶颈,热点数据太多,数据库缓存放不下,每次查询会产生大量的IO,降低查询速度 第二种:网络IO瓶颈,请求的数据太多,网络带宽不够 二、数据库性能瓶颈-CPU瓶颈 第一种:SQl问题:如SQL中包含join,group by, order by,非索引字 阅读全文
posted @ 2024-04-26 14:07 风筝遇上风 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 一、什么是执行计划 用户提交的 sql 语句,数据库查询优化器,经过分析生成多个数据库可以识别的高效执行查询方式。然 后优化器会在众多执行计划中找出一个资源使用最少,而不是最快的执行方案,给你展示出来,可以是 文本格式,也可以是图形化的执行方案。 二、为什么要读懂执行计划? 首先执行计划让你知道你复 阅读全文
posted @ 2024-03-21 09:52 风筝遇上风 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 一、数据库设计的重要性 在系统研发中,数据库作为数据的保存介质,那么数据库如何保存业务数据。这就需要开发者来设计 了。当数据库比较复杂(如数据量大,表较多,业务关系复杂)时: 1、良好的数据库设计可以: 节省数据的存储空间 能够保证数据的完整性 方便进行数据库应用系统的开发 2、糟糕的数据库设计 数 阅读全文
posted @ 2024-03-21 09:51 风筝遇上风 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 一、SqlServer概述 SQL Server 数据库支持多个用户同时访问数据库,但当用户同时访问数据库时,就会造成并发问题,锁的机制能很好地解决这个问题,保证数据的完整性和一致性; SQL Server 自带锁机制,若是简单的数据库访问机制,完全能满足用户的需求;但对于数据完全与数据完整性有特殊 阅读全文
posted @ 2024-02-20 10:23 风筝遇上风 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 一、什么是事务? 事务是在数据库上按照一定的逻辑顺序执行的任务序列,是恢复和控制并发的基本单位,既可以由用户手动执行,也可以由某种数据库程序自动执行。 事务究竟有什么价值呢? 转账: 张三像李四转账一万块钱; 业务操作: 存在两个操作; 业务中,必须要保证两个操作都成功才行! 1、张三的账户 存款减 阅读全文
posted @ 2024-02-20 10:23 风筝遇上风 阅读(6) 评论(0) 推荐(0) 编辑
摘要: 一、什么是游标? 游标是一种能从包含多个元组的集合中每次读取一个元组的机制。游标总是和一段SELECT语句关联, SELECT语句查询出的结果集就作为集合,游标能每次从该集合中读取出一个元组进行不同操作。 二、游标的核心价值 1. 将游标定位在结果集特定元组。 2. 将游标指定结果集中的元组数据读出 阅读全文
posted @ 2024-01-12 14:39 风筝遇上风 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 一、索引基本概念 在数据库中建立索引是为了加快数据的查询速度。数据库中的索引与书籍中的目录或书后的术语表类 似。在一本书中,利用目录或术语表可以快速查找所需信息,而无须翻阅整本书。在数据库中,索引使 对数据的查找不需要对整个表进行扫描,就可以在其中找到所需数据。书籍的索引表是一个词语列表, 其中注明 阅读全文
posted @ 2024-01-12 14:39 风筝遇上风 阅读(13) 评论(0) 推荐(0) 编辑
摘要: 在之前的SQL SERVER版本中,一般采用GUID或者IDENTITY来作为标示符,但是IDENTITY是一个表 对象,只能保证在一张表里面的序列,当我们遇到以下情况时: 如上表,我们需要在多表之间,实现ID的一致性,在SQL SERVER里面就会有一定的麻烦,通常我们会 使用额外使用一张TEMP 阅读全文
posted @ 2023-12-28 14:16 风筝遇上风 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 什么是约束? SqlServer数据库为了保存的数据更具备准确性,一致性,在SqlServer中支持的有约束,有规则来限 定,如果符合规则就可以保存,如果不符合,就不能保存。SQL下有以下几种约束: 1. 主键约束 2. 外键约束 3. Not Null约束 4. 唯一约束 5. 检查约束 一、主键 阅读全文
posted @ 2023-12-28 14:16 风筝遇上风 阅读(3) 评论(0) 推荐(0) 编辑